Effect Of Top Pruning And Growth Regulators On Growth And Potassium Nutrition Of Tobacco

This paper studied the effect of top pruning and plant growth regulators at squaring stage on the growth and development, and the absorption, and accumulation of potassium of tobacco( Nicotiana tabacum L) by methods of water culture and pot trial. The results showed that:1. Top pruning can improve the root system activity of tobacco, the activity of Nitrate reductase and content of chlorphyll in leaf. At the same time, the activity of Nitrate reductase and content of chlorphyll in leaf can also be raised when plenteous potassium was supplied after top pruning.2.Potassium in tobacco has the trend of transferring from leaf to stem and root when tobacco developed to anaphase. The measure of top pruning can promote potassium transfer from root to stem and leaf, increase the potassium content in tobacco leaf. While the treatment of no top pruning, potassium transferred from leaf to stem and root, reduced the potassium content in leaf.3.Nipping different plant growth regulators after top pruning has promotion on plant height, stem circumference, the largest leaf area, node distance, root volume, root fresh weight, and area of the second leaf from top, and different plant growth regulators has different promotions, among them BR has the most prominent effect followed by GA3 and NAA, 2,4-D has the least effect. Plant growth regulators have no effect on tobacco's leaf number significantly. Applying potassium in higher level have no prominent effects on plant height, stem circumference, the largest leaf area, nodes distance, root volume and area of the second leaf from top, but can increase the root fresh weight significantly.4. Nipping different plant growth regulators after top pruning can increase the potassium accumulation of different part in tobacco, promoted potassium transfer from root and stem to leaf, increased the potassium content of middle and top part of leaf in tobacco, improved the quality of tobacco. 5. Nipping different plant growth regulators after top pruning can increase the accumulation of N, P in tobacco, have no prominent effects on the accumulation of Ca, Mg, Mn and Zn. Potassium can increase the accumulation of N, P, Mn and Zn but restrained the accumulation of Ca and Mg.
